The Mad, Bad and Dangerous to Know are coming to Medway... and it is a work in progress

Image credit Doctor_Bob
As part of the Rochester literature festival, the ME4Writers are curating an intriguing exhibition, and they would like to invite you to take part. Are you interested?

The assemblance of judicious heretics is an open access collaborative project. The idea is to encourage artists of all styles to send in work to complement a series of writing pieces on the theme of Mad, Bad and Dangerous to Know.

The exhibition will be displayed in Rochester during September and October. If you would like to know more, please see the details on the ME4Writers blog here. You don't have to be based in Medway, you can send in work as long as you can deliver the art to Rochester.

ME4Writers - Book jackets for books never to be written

The ME4Writers have shared a sneak peek of one of their works in progress. It goes by the intriguing title Book jackets for books never to be written

It's an on-going project that encourages collaboration between writers and artists, and the idea is to design a book cover for a book that will never get written.


I've seen some of the designs, and they are quite startling. Would you like to be involved? Either an an artist or writer, please give it a try. You never know what you are capable of until you do it.

If you would like to contribute either a book jacket blurb or design a cover, more information about the project is available on the ME4Writers blog here
